## Break-Glass: Largediff Viewer

Scope: emergency access to the Ashgrove diff service when reviewing files over 500 MB and normal auth is down.

Use only if a blocking review cannot wait for auth recovery. Access is logged and audited within 24 hours. Open the break-glass console, select the largediff tier, and acknowledge the audit banner. Authenticate at the final prompt with the recovery passphrase below.

vault phrase of hawif-bahof = novvan-belius-istael-fenvan-holdor-druox-eliath

Night shift: evacuation-chair store on Stairwell C, Level 3, was restocked today. Two Havermont chairs serviced, one sent to Drayle Safety for repair. Check the seal on the store door at 02:00 rounds. If the seal is broken, log it and re-secure. Door access for the store uses the pass below.

staff pass of fajop-kajop = bdg-H-83

TICKET-4821: Canary gating misconfigured in the Verdalia staging cluster. The gating rules for the Plumeline rollout currently read promotion thresholds from the production profile, so canaries auto-promote without error-budget checks. Fix is to point the gate evaluator at the staging profile and re-verify. For the security review, the gate evaluator also needs its signing secret set in the env file, on the line directly below this comment.

vault entry, yahif-yajep: COURIER_KEY29=b802bdf8034096b65a51c6ba5abe2